MS-DOS 및 Windows 명령 줄 bootsect 명령

차례:

MS-DOS 및 Windows 명령 줄 bootsect 명령
MS-DOS 및 Windows 명령 줄 bootsect 명령

비디오: 윈도우10 부팅오류 시 해결 방법과 개인파일 백업 (OrangeStar) 2024, 할 수있다

비디오: 윈도우10 부팅오류 시 해결 방법과 개인파일 백업 (OrangeStar) 2024, 할 수있다
Anonim

bootsect의 명령은 하드 디스크 파티션이 BOOTMGR과 NTLDR 사이를 전환하기 위해 마스터 부트 코드를 업데이트합니다. 이 도구를 사용하여 컴퓨터의 부트 섹터를 복원 할 수 있으며 FAT 및 NTFS 기반 파일 시스템에 사용하여 FixFAT 및 FixNTFS 도구를 대체 할 수 있습니다.

유효성

Bootsect 명령은 다음 버전의 Microsoft 운영 체제에서 bootsec.exe로 사용할 수있는 외부 명령입니다.

  • 윈도우 2000
  • 윈도우 XP
  • 윈도우 비스타
  • 윈도우 7
  • 윈도우 8
  • 윈도우 10

Bootsect 구문

bootsect / help SYS [/ force] [/ mbr]

드라이브: 검색 할 드라이브 문자입니다.
/도움 이러한 사용법 지침을 표시합니다.
/ nt52 NTLDR과 호환되는 마스터 부트 코드를 SYS, ALL 또는에 적용합니다. SYS, ALL에 설치된 운영 체제는 Windows Vista보다 오래된 버전이어야합니다.
/ nt60 BOOTMGR과 호환되는 마스터 부트 코드를 SYS, ALL 또는에 적용합니다. SYS, ALL에 설치된 운영 체제이거나 Windows Vista, Windows Server 2008 이상이어야합니다.
SYS Windows 부팅에 사용 된 시스템 파티션의 마스터 부팅 코드를 업데이트합니다.
모두 모든 파티션에서 마스터 부트 코드를 업데이트합니다. ALL이 반드시 각 볼륨의 부트 코드를 업데이트하지는 않습니다. 대신이 옵션은 Windows 부팅 볼륨으로 사용될 수있는 볼륨의 부팅 코드를 업데이트하여 기본 디스크 파티션과 연결되지 않은 동적 볼륨은 제외합니다. 부팅 코드는 디스크 파티션의 시작 부분에 있어야하기 때문에 이러한 제한 사항이 있습니다.
이 드라이브 문자와 관련된 볼륨의 마스터 부트 코드를 업데이트합니다. 1) 볼륨과 연결되어 있지 않거나 2) 기본 디스크 파티션에 연결되지 않은 볼륨과 연결되어 있으면 부팅 코드가 업데이트되지 않습니다.
/힘 부팅 코드 업데이트 중에 볼륨을 강제로 분리합니다. 이 옵션은주의해서 사용해야합니다.

Bootsect.exe가 단독 볼륨 액세스를 얻을 수없는 경우 파일 시스템은 다음에 다시 부팅하기 전에 부팅 코드를 덮어 쓸 수 있습니다. Bootsect.exe는 각 업데이트 전에 항상 볼륨을 잠 그거나 분리하려고합니다. / force를 지정하면 초기 잠금 시도가 실패하면 강제 마운트 해제가 시도됩니다. 예를 들어, 대상 볼륨의 파일이 현재 다른 프로그램에 의해 열려있는 경우 잠금이 실패 할 수 있습니다.

성공하면 강제 분리를 통해 초기 잠금이 실패한 경우에도 독점 볼륨 액세스와 안정적인 부팅 코드 업데이트가 가능합니다. 동시에 강제 분리는 대상 볼륨의 파일에 대한 열린 핸들을 모두 무효화하여 이러한 파일을 연 프로그램에서 예기치 않은 동작을 발생시킵니다. 따라서이 옵션을주의해서 사용해야합니다.

/ mbr SYS, ALL 또는 드라이브 문자로 지정된 파티션이 포함 된 디스크의 섹터 0에서 파티션 테이블을 변경하지 않고 마스터 부트 레코드를 업데이트합니다. / nt52 옵션과 함께 사용하면 마스터 부트 레코드는 Windows Vista 이전의 운영 체제와 호환됩니다. / nt60 옵션과 함께 사용하면 마스터 부팅 레코드는 Windows Vista, Windows Server 2008 이상과 호환됩니다.